Rad AI Impressions is an AI‑enabled software solution that automatically generates a draft impression of a radiology report based on the radiologist's dictated findings, helping save time, improve accuracy, and reduce burnout. It runs alongside your existing reporting software and inserts a draft impression with consensus-based guideline recommendation directly into the report for the radiologist to review and edit.

No. Rad AI Impressions is a physician‑augmentation tool, not a replacement for medical judgment. A licensed radiologist must always review the AI‑generated impression, edit it as needed and sign the final report.

Rad AI Impressions integrates with leading radiology reporting systems (such as PowerScribe and Fluency) via a lightweight desktop client. As you dictate findings, Rad AI Impressions securely captures the report text, generates a draft impression in seconds and inserts it directly into the Impression section of your existing report editor — no change to your core reporting platform or voice recognition vendor.

Impressions supports common radiology modalities, including:

• CR X‑ray (computed radiography)
• CT (computed tomography)
• PET/CT (positron emission tomography/computed tomography)
• MR (magnetic resonance)
• US (ultrasound)
• MG (mammography)

The AI model automatically adapts the impression based on the detected modality.

Rad AI Impressions is trained on a large, diverse corpus of de‑identified historical radiology reports (no images) to build a generalized model for drafting impressions. For each site, de‑identified historical reports (typically 3–5 years) are used to customize the model to individual radiologists so that output more closely matches their language, style, and reporting patterns.

Rad AI Continuity is an AI-powered follow-up management platform that automatically detects imaging follow-up recommendations in radiology reports, helps navigators coordinate communication with providers and patients, and tracks every recommendation through to resolution so patients receive timely, appropriate follow-up care. It gives health systems and radiology groups a unified, closed-loop workflow for imaging follow-up.

No. Rad AI Continuity doesn’t replace clinical judgment or navigator roles. Radiologists still determine whether follow-up is needed and document recommendations in the report, and navigators and providers still decide how best to act on those recommendations. Rad AI Continuity’s role is to surface the right patients, automate routine steps, and keep status up to date so teams can focus on higher-value clinical work rather than manual tracking.

Rad AI Continuity integrates with your existing EHR and radiology information system using standard interfaces (such as HL7 results, orders, and ADT messages), so there’s no need to change your core systems. Finalized radiology reports are sent securely to Rad AI Continuity for AI analysis; follow-up entries then flow back into worklists, provider and patient communications, and status updates that stay in sync with your EHR scheduling and results workflows.

Rad AI Continuity can track follow-up imaging recommendations across a wide range of categories and programs, such as pulmonary nodules (including Fleischner-based follow-up) and incidental thyroid nodules (TI-RADS), among others. Findings are organized into standardized categories and subcategories, so your team can manage diverse follow-up workflows from a single, prioritized worklist.

Rad AI Continuity uses AI and natural language processing to identify follow-up recommendations and map them into clinically meaningful categories and timeframes. During implementation, Rad AI configures Continuity to your environment — tailoring categories, subcategories, due-date logic and exam-code mappings — so that entries align with your existing reporting patterns, consensus guidelines and routing rules. Over time, configuration and rules can be refined to reflect your evolving clinical policies and program goals.

Radiology reporting software helps radiologists create and manage medical imaging reports. Rad AI Reporting enhances this process with a personalized experience that harnesses the power of generative AI (GenAI), structured templates, advanced speech intelligence and workflow automation to improve accuracy, efficiency and consistency.

Rad AI's speech intelligence was built on the latest healthcare speech models, then deeply tuned for radiology with thousands of hours of radiologist dictation and specialty-specific terminology. The result is significantly lower error rates, a faster, real-time dictation flow and fewer interruptions than legacy solutions, allowing users to remain focused on their interpretation.

Rad AI Reporting

Rad AI learns each radiologist's language, style and reporting patterns from historical reports and live dictation to generate text that sounds like them. This includes impressions and unchanged follow-up exams where only true changes need to be dictated. It also adapts to how radiologists work — preserving their preferred templates, macros, guidelines, layouts and dictation habits — so the entire reporting experience feels personal while maintaining structure and consistency.
